24 Mar 2020 Functions are subprograms in VHDL. You can use functions for implementing frequently used algorithms. A function takes zero or more input 

8140

Procedure Statement - VHDL Example. Procedures are part of a group of structures called subprograms. Procedures are small sections of code that perform an operation that is reused throughout your code. This serves to cleanup code as well as allow for reusability. Procedures can take inputs and generate outputs.

For more information, see the following sections of the IEEE Std 1076-1993 IEEE Standard VHDL Language Reference Manual: Section 8.6: If Statement. Section 8.8: … 2017-10-26 When looking at Verilog and VHDL code at the same time, the most obvious difference is Verilog does not have library management while VHDL does include design libraries on the top of the code. VHDL libraries contain compiled architectures, entities, packages, and configurations. This feature is very useful when managing large design structures. This allows us to test designs while working through the VHDL tutorials on this site. Architecture of a Basic VHDL Testbench.

While vhdl

  1. Vad är vilseledande marknadsföring
  2. President i brasilien
  3. Hotel elite
  4. Homan auto
  5. Canvas supported file types
  6. Funktionellt beroende
  7. Statens offentliga utredningar english
  8. Hur upptäcker man diabetes typ 2
  9. Criminal minds season 4
  10. Vad betyder perception

There is the implicit “process loop”, the While Learn how to to create a loop in VHDL, and how to break out of it. Jim Duckworth, WPI 16 Advanced Testing using VHDL LOOP Statements • Used to iterate through a set of sequential statements • Three types FOR identifier IN range LOOP END LOOP; WHILE boolean_expression LOOP END LOOP; LOOP EXIT WHEN condition_test END LOOP; While VHDL included a wide range of data types, it lacked the ability to represent multi-valued logic, so an additional standard was created to define std_logic and its vector equivalent. This was a 9-value logic system and became IEEE 1164. VHDL went through IEEE updates in 1993, 2000, 2002, 2008 and Accellera updates in 2006 and 2008. For more information, see the following sections of the IEEE Std 1076-1993 IEEE Standard VHDL Language Reference Manual: Section 8.6: If Statement.

2019-01-22 History of VHDL. VHDL was developed by the Department of Defence (DOD) in 1980.

VHDL allows one to describe a digital system at the structural or the behavioral level. The behavioral level can be further divided into two kinds of styles: Data flowand Algorithmic. The dataflow representation describes how data moves through the system. This is typically

digital, VHDL, MCU, and mixed electronic circuits including also SMPS, RF, while Educators will welcome its unique features for the training environment  الكورس دا مصمم خصيصاً عالشان يخلك قادر تصمم و تنفذ و تعمل debugging الألواح الإلكترونية لتصميمات معقدة لل (FPGAs) عن طريق تصميم VHDL. الكورس هيكون  generates mixed 8086 & 80386 inline assembly, so you can get some benefit while running in a 16-bit environment on 32-bit hardware (DOS, Windows 3.1. VUnit is an open source unit testing framework for VHDL/SystemVerilog We also assist organizations while implementing Vuint as a natural part of the way of  Alla VHDL Test jobb i Sverige. Sök och hitta When you imagine your next project, you see yourself creating a new PCB design while handling th… 18 dagar  The focus of this thesis is on DAC while the DDS is developed in VHDL as another thesis work.

While vhdl

2020-04-02

While vhdl

This thesis demonstrates a low-power, ultra wide band 10 bit  We believe in constantly trying to facilitate and improve the recruitment process for all parties by being agile and quick while maintaining a personal and highly  IP development • RTL design using VHDL and/or SV • Block verification using introducing e-commerce businesses and retailers to Airmee while developing  GRUNDER I VHDL Innehåll Komponentmodell Kodmodell Entity Architecture (scope) Iteration while Klasser Objekt Metoder Metodhuvudet Kodstandarden. Knowledge in VHDL or C#. and experience from other industries while still getting opportunities for personal and professional development. Detta kompendium i VHDL gör på intet sätt anspråk på att vara fullständigt. Det behandlar bara de repetitionssat av typen while-sats.

A DFF samples its input on one or the other edge of its clock (not both) while a latch is transparent on one level of its enable and memorizing on the other. Conclusion – Verilog vs VHDL.
Den perfekte vännen frågor

13 Standard Digital Circuits in VHDL. 161. 13.1 RET D Flip-flop - Behavioral Model. There are three primary types of loops in VHDL: for loops, while loops, and infinite loops.

In this second example, we implement a VHDL signed comparator that is used to wrap around an unsigned counter. Figure 3 – Signed Comparator architecture VHDL lets you define sub-programs using procedures and functions. They are used to improve the readability and to exploit re-usability of VHDL code.
Leksands knäckebröd tin

helhetshälsa helamin
moms danmark procent
civil utredare försäkringskassan
dust mites rash
delphi or spectra fuel pump

2017-10-26

If you really want a latch, this is how to create one: process(enable, d) begin if enable = '1' then q <= d; end if; end process; But most latches are accidentally inferred because there’s something wrong with your VHDL process. The code below shows a typical accidental latch inference. Examples of VHDL Conversions Using both Numeric_Std and Std_Logic_Arith Package Files.


Hur lång tid tar det att registrera företag
vad innebär proteinreducerad kost

way of interpreting the surrounding, all while consuming micro Watt of power. of processors and the GRLIB VHDL IP-library used for System-on-Chip (SoC) 

Assert statement checks that the input d has not had an event during the setup time.